Subject: Re: [PATCH v1 2/2] drm/i915:gen9: Add disable gather at set shader w/a
Date: Mon, 3 Aug 2015 16:21:53 -0700 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20150803232153.GB30812@intel.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1438629897-2993-3-git-send-email-arun.siluvery@linux.intel.com>
On Mon, Aug 03, 2015 at 08:24:57PM +0100, Arun Siluvery wrote:
> This WA is implemented in init_context as well as WA batch init.
> There are also some dependent bits need to be set in other registers
> for this to be complete.
>
> Cc: Ben Widawsky <benjamin.widawsky@intel.com>
> Cc: Joonas Lahtinen <joonas.lahtinen@linux.intel.com>
> Signed-off-by: Arun Siluvery <arun.siluvery@linux.intel.com>
> ---
> drivers/gpu/drm/i915/i915_reg.h | 3 +++
> drivers/gpu/drm/i915/intel_lrc.c | 8 ++++++++
> drivers/gpu/drm/i915/intel_ringbuffer.c | 16 ++++++++++++++++
> 3 files changed, 27 insertions(+)
>
> diff --git a/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/i915_reg.h b/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/i915_reg.h
> index 8991cd5..24b8bb9 100644
> --- a/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/i915_reg.h
> +++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/i915_reg.h
> @@ -1720,7 +1720,9 @@ enum skl_disp_power_wells {
> #define MEM_DISPLAY_A_TRICKLE_FEED_DISABLE (1<<2) /* 830/845 only */
> #define MEM_DISPLAY_TRICKLE_FEED_DISABLE (1<<2) /* 85x only */
> #define FW_BLC 0x020d8
> +#define GEN9_DISABLE_GATHER_AT_SET_SHADER (1<<7)
> #define FW_BLC2 0x020dc
> +#define GEN9_RS_CHICKEN_DISABLE_GATHER_AT_SHADER (1<<2)
Neither of these belong here. BLC is for backlight. Create a new define if we
don't have one.
#define RS_CHICKEN 0x20dc
> #define FW_BLC_SELF 0x020e0 /* 915+ only */
> #define FW_BLC_SELF_EN_MASK (1<<31)
> #define FW_BLC_SELF_FIFO_MASK (1<<16) /* 945 only */
> @@ -5836,6 +5838,7 @@ enum skl_disp_power_wells {
> # define GEN7_CSC1_RHWO_OPT_DISABLE_IN_RCC ((1<<10) | (1<<26))
> # define GEN9_RHWO_OPTIMIZATION_DISABLE (1<<14)
> #define COMMON_SLICE_CHICKEN2 0x7014
> +#define GEN9_DISABLE_GATHER_SET_SHADER_SLICE (1<<12)
> # define GEN8_CSC2_SBE_VUE_CACHE_CONSERVATIVE (1<<0)
>
> #define HIZ_CHICKEN 0x7018
> diff --git a/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/intel_lrc.c b/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/intel_lrc.c
> index 9faad82..d3a03f3 100644
> --- a/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/intel_lrc.c
> +++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/intel_lrc.c
> @@ -1292,6 +1292,14 @@ static int gen9_init_perctx_bb(struct intel_engine_cs *ring,
> struct drm_device *dev = ring->dev;
> uint32_t index = wa_ctx_start(wa_ctx, *offset, CACHELINE_DWORDS);
>
> + /* WA to reset "disable gather at set shader slice" bit */
> + if (IS_SKYLAKE(dev)) {
> + wa_ctx_emit(batch, index, MI_LOAD_REGISTER_IMM(1));
> + wa_ctx_emit(batch, index, COMMON_SLICE_CHICKEN2);
> + wa_ctx_emit(batch, index,
> + _MASKED_BIT_DISABLE(GEN9_DISABLE_GATHER_SET_SHADER_SLICE));
> + }
> +
Shouldn't this be for BXT as well? Also, why bother with the revid check below
and not here?
> /* WaSetDisablePixMaskCammingAndRhwoInCommonSliceChicken:skl,bxt */
> if ((IS_SKYLAKE(dev) && (INTEL_REVID(dev) <= SKL_REVID_B0)) ||
> (IS_BROXTON(dev) && (INTEL_REVID(dev) == BXT_REVID_A0))) {
> diff --git a/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/intel_ringbuffer.c b/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/intel_ringbuffer.c
> index dcd1b8f..4fc4b5e 100644
> --- a/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/intel_ringbuffer.c
> +++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/intel_ringbuffer.c
> @@ -985,6 +985,15 @@ static int gen9_init_workarounds(struct intel_engine_cs *ring)
> tmp |= HDC_FORCE_CSR_NON_COHERENT_OVR_DISABLE;
> WA_SET_BIT_MASKED(HDC_CHICKEN0, tmp);
>
> + /* WA to gather at set shader - skl,bxt
> + * These are dependent bits need to be set for the WA.
> + */
> + if (IS_SKYLAKE(dev) && (INTEL_REVID(dev) > SKL_REVID_D0) ||
> + (IS_BROXTON(dev) && INTEL_REVID(dev) > BXT_REVID_A0)) {
> + WA_SET_BIT_MASKED(FW_BLC, GEN9_DISABLE_GATHER_AT_SET_SHADER);
> + WA_SET_BIT_MASKED(FW_BLC2, GEN9_RS_CHICKEN_DISABLE_GATHER_AT_SHADER);
> + }
> +
> return 0;
> }
>
> @@ -1068,6 +1077,13 @@ static int skl_init_workarounds(struct intel_engine_cs *ring)
> HDC_FENCE_DEST_SLM_DISABLE |
> HDC_BARRIER_PERFORMANCE_DISABLE);
>
> + /* WA to Disable gather at set shader - skl
> + * This bit needs to be reset in Per ctx WA batch and it is also
> + * dependent on other bits in different register, all of them need
> + * be set for the WA to be complete.
> + */
> + WA_SET_BIT_MASKED(COMMON_SLICE_CHICKEN2, GEN9_DISABLE_GATHER_SET_SHADER_SLICE);
> +
> return skl_tune_iz_hashing(ring);
> }
>
I wouldn't set both 20dc, and 20d8, I am not sure what implication it has.
Instead, set or read bit 15 of 0x20e0 and then just set one. To me, it seems
like the best way to do this is to set 1<<15 of 0x20e0, and then use bit 2 of
0x20dc for the workaround. We don't need per context controls of something we
have to disable always anyway.
